For anyone who has an address in the United Kingdom, please sign the petition to stop the culling of badgers. It's being done to supposedly prevent the spread of bovine TB, which is a serious disease. However, the science doesn't back up the killing of badgers and may make it worse by causing perturbation. This is the movement of badgers caused by change in the population through culling.

To me, there are three critical parts to a book. The first half of the first chapter; major characters are introduced, tone and theme are set. If you don't have them hooked halfway through chapter 1, you're screwed and they may not continue. The final chapter, all questions should be answered and give closure unless continuation via sequels. Third; the backstory. No matter where you put it in the book, you eventually should explain why things are the way they are. If it's a series, you can stretch that, just as long as you don't contradict previous information.
